Predictable pulp capping procedures remain problematic, possibly because of the lack of appropriate stimulating factors for dentin formation. The present study examines the ability of one such stimulating factor, bone morphogenetic protein-2, to accelerate the differentiation of human dental pulp cells into odontoblasts. ATP-dependent profiles of phosphofructokinase (PFK) activity were determined in both crude and Sephadex G-25-filtered fractions from rabbit dental pulp. ATP had a dual effect on PFK as an activator and an inhibitor, according to its concentration.
